Police use chopper to rescue lost man surrounded by bulls on Auckland bike track

Auckland's Eagle police helicopter has rescued a man after he fell off his bike and became surrounded by bulls in Maraetai on Monday afternoon.

The man, who didn't want to be named, told Newshub once he came off his bike on the Whitford bike track, he realised he was lost and he called emergency services for help.

It was then that he noticed he had company. At least 20 bulls had surrounded the man.

He held his bike above him as protection as the curious bulls moved closer towards him.

"I had no idea what they were going to do," he said.

The cyclist's exact location was not known, so Eagle carried out a search of the area.

The man remained still until help arrived.

"Eagle attended to do a flyover and located the male, who was extracted by Eagle and dropped off on the main road," a police spokesperson said.

The man said he was extremely grateful for the help of police and the Eagle helicopter before continuing on his journey - this time, sticking to the road.
